Elizabeth PD watches campaign sign, calls the mayor
Police director finds time to personally supervise two lieutenants handling a minor dispute over a campaign sign belonging to someone criticizing the mayor. Then calls the mayor's cell immediately after.
That's not service. That's a signal.
Gotta hand it to the Elizabeth PD. It may be NJ's 4th largest city, but they offer a personal touch. The city's police director somehow found an hour and a half to watch two lieutenants deal with a minor dispute about a campaign sign of one of the mayor's critics. That's service.
